Requiring a majority vote of the medical quality assurance commission to revoke a physician's license. 


    AN ACT Relating to the revocation of a physician's license; and amending RCW 18.71.019.

 

B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F WASHINGTON:

 

    Sec. 1.  RCW 18.71.019 and 1994 sp.s. c 9 s 305 are each amended to read as follows:

    The Uniform Disciplinary Act, chapter 18.130 RCW, governs unlicensed practice and the issuance and denial of licenses and discipline of licensees under this chapter.  When a panel of the commission revokes a license, the respondent may request review of the revocation order of the panel by the remaining members of the commission not involved in the initial investigation.  The respondent's request for review must be filed within twenty days of the effective date of the order revoking the respondent's license.  The review shall be scheduled for hearing by the remaining members of the commission not involved in the initial investigation within sixty days.  The commission shall adopt rules establishing review procedures.
